Iqvia’s origins can be traced back to the merger of two industry giants – Quintiles and IMS Health – in 2016, creating a powerhouse of knowledge and experience. Quintiles, founded in 1982 by Dennis Gillings, was renowned for its clinical research capabilities, whereas IMS Health, established in 1954 by Bill Frohlich, focused on healthcare information and technology services. The merger was a strategic move to combine their respective strengths, thus enabling the newly-formed Iqvia to offer an unparalleled suite of services that cater to the entire healthcare product lifecycle.

A cornerstone of Iqvia’s success is its ability to harness the power of data and advanced analytics. The company boasts one of the largest and most comprehensive collections of healthcare data, ranging from clinical trial information and prescription data to electronic health records and disease registries. With petabytes of structured and unstructured data at their disposal, Iqvia’s data scientists and analysts employ sophisticated analytical techniques to extract meaningful insights and deliver data-driven solutions.

Iqvia’s innovative technology solutions are another key differentiator that sets it apart from its competitors. The company’s technology platforms, such as Orchestrated Customer Engagement (OCE) and Iqvia CORE, provide a seamless, integrated ecosystem that enables its clients to collaborate effectively, streamline processes, and optimize their operations. These platforms leverage automation, predictive modeling, and real-time data to drive efficiencies and facilitate better decision-making throughout the product lifecycle.
